Otis Elevator Company - President and Chairman

President and Chairman

  • Elisha Graves Otis and Susan A. Houghton, circa 1853
  • William Delavan Baldwin, circa 1926
  • Percy L. Douglas, ? to 1964
  • Fayette S. Dunn, 1964 to ?
  • Didier Michaud-Daniel, 2008 to 2012
  • Pedro Sainz de Baranda, 2012 to present
